Sunday, February 2nd, MSNBC Films presents “King of the Apocalypse,” an NBC News Studios production. The documentary delves into the turbulent life of Oath Keepers founder Stewart Rhodes through the lens of his now-estranged and de-radicalized family – all as President Trump commuted Rhodes' prison sentence for his role on January 6th. Watch “King of the Apocalypse” Sunday, February 2nd at 9pm ET on MSNBC. “King of the Apocalypse” is a production from MSNBC Films, NBC News Studios, Sky Studios, and Noble Beast.
